DSGR Outperforms Revenue Expectations
Distribution Solutions Group, Inc., commonly referred to as DSGR (NASDAQ:DSGR), is a key player in the specialty distribution sector. The company, best known for its broad-scale distribution solutions, operates out of Fort Worth, Texas. As a competitive entity in the distribution space, DSGR is consistently striving to maintain its edge through strategic operations and strong financial performance.
On October 31, 2024, DSGR reported its earnings, revealing a revenue of approximately $468 million. This result notably exceeded analysts’ estimates, which predicted a revenue of $466 million. This overperformance highlights DSGR’s robust operational capabilities and its ability to generate solid revenue amidst market uncertainties.

Investor Confidence Reflected in High P/E Ratio
DSGR’s financial metrics reveal intriguing insights. The company has a high price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io of 796.2, indicating that investors are willing to pay a substantial premium for its earnings. This high valuation strongly suggests that investors are confident in DSGR’s future growth prospects.
However, the earnings yield of 0.13% indicates a modest return on investment from earnings. This disparity between the high P/E ratio and the low earnings yield reflects the market’s optimism regarding DSGR’s growth potential, despite its current earnings performance.
DSGR’s Market Valuation
Another critical metric, the price-to-sales ratio, is approximately 1.04 for DSGR. This suggests that the market values DSGR slightly above its sales revenue. Additionally, the enterprise value to sales ratio is about 1.49, indicating the company’s valuation in relation to its sales. These figures suggest that DSGR is valued fairly in the market, considering its capability to generate revenue.
DSGR Maintains Solid Liquidity Position
DSGR maintains a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.24, indicating a moderate level of debt compared to its equity. This suggests a balanced approach to leveraging debt for growth, showing DSGR’s strategy to maintain financial stability while pursuing expansion.
The current ratio of 2.81 further highlights DSGR’s strong ability to cover short-term liabilities with its short-term assets. This reflects a solid liquidity position, which is crucial for any company to weather unexpected financial challenges or take advantage of sudden growth opportunities.
